晚安,做个好梦
wǎn ān , zuò gè hǎo mèng
Sweet dream good night · trad. 晚安,做個好夢
晚安 (wǎn'ān) is the standard way to say "good night" in Mandarin Chinese. To add "sweet dreams," you can say 做个好梦 (zuò ge hǎo mèng) after it, making a warm and complete farewell before sleep.
When to use it
晚安 is neutral and polite, suitable for most situations. Adding 祝你 (zhù nǐ, "wish you") before 做个好梦 makes it a complete sentence, 祝你做个好梦, which is slightly more formal. Among very close friends or family, sometimes just "好梦" (hǎo mèng) is used as a short form for "sweet dreams."
How to pronounce it
晚安 sounds like "wahn-AHN." 晚 is a third tone (falling-rising), 安 is a first tone (high-level). 做个好梦 sounds like "zwoh guh HOW mung." 做 is a fourth tone (falling), 个 is a neutral tone, 好 is a third tone, 梦 is a fourth tone.
Other ways to say it
- 晚安wǎn āngood night (standard)
- 祝你晚安zhù nǐ wǎn ānwish you good night (slightly more formal)
- 做个好梦zuò gè hǎo mènghave a good dream (can be used alone or appended)
- 好梦hǎo mèngsweet dreams (concise, informal)
Examples
晚安,做个好梦!
wǎn ān , zuò gè hǎo mèng !
Good night, sweet dreams!
爸爸妈妈,晚安!
bà ba mā ma , wǎn ān !
Good night, Dad and Mom!
早点休息,祝你有个好梦。
zǎo diǎn xiū xi , zhù nǐ yǒu gè hǎo mèng 。
Rest early, wish you a good dream.
